12 Dec 2019 Scheme is a functional programming language and one of the two main dialects of the programming language Lisp. Scheme follows a 

7649

Erik Naggum är en Lisp-programmerare med väldigt färgstark personlighet Man kan lätt få intrycket att han inte tycker särskilt mycket om Perl, C++ eller Scheme. "It's not that perl programmers are idiots, it's that the language rewards idiotic 

Computer Science Department, University of Oxford Evaluation of measures for statistical fault localisation and an optimising scheme ACM Transactions on Programming Languages and Systems (TOPLAS) 40 (2), 5, 2018. 50+ programming languages: Clojure, Haskell, Kotlin (beta), QBasic, Forth, LOLCODE, BrainF, Emoticon, Bloop, Unlambda, JavaScript, CoffeeScript, Scheme,  Versions of LISP Lisp is an old language with many variants Lisp is alive and well today Most modern versions are based on Common Lisp LispWorks. Lists in  Pros and Cons of PHP Programming Language ProsCons December 14, 2018 Computer and NET, AspectJ, Perl, Ruby, PHP & Scheme - … Perler Beads . 26 jan. 2021 — High level Common Lisp including syntax macros • Good knowledge of programming languages such as Java, C#, C, Haskell and Scheme Erik Naggum är en Lisp-programmerare med väldigt färgstark personlighet Man kan lätt få intrycket att han inte tycker särskilt mycket om Perl, C++ eller Scheme.

  1. Angolansk gerilla
  2. Vidta åtgärd engelska
  3. Crm sw

Scheme is a programming language that is a variation of Lisp.It was created in 1975 by Guy Steele and Gerry Sussman at MIT's Artificial Intelligence lab. It was the first dialect of Lisp that required its implementations to use tail call optimization, placing a strong emphasis on functional programming and recursive algorithms, in particular. Chapter 1. Introduction. Scheme is a general-purpose computer programming language.

Books freely available online: The Scheme Programming Language, 4 ed (the 3 and 2 editions are also available) How to Design Programs (written to be used 

We provide a definition & history. Scheme Programming Language books at E-Books Directory: files with free access on the Internet. These books are made freely available by their respective   Lambda calculus was the inspiration for functional programming.

6 Mar 2016 3. About Scheme programming language Scheme • is primarily a functional programming language. It shares many characteristics with other 

Scheme Writability. Simply  Type-C: Clojure-like - persistent data structures, namespaces and vars, protocols, etc. Type-L: Common Lisp; Type-S: Scheme. Languages. Listed primarily by the  12 Dec 2019 Scheme is a functional programming language and one of the two main dialects of the programming language Lisp. Scheme follows a  The form and meaning of programs written in the Scheme programming language and in particular, their syntax, the semantic rules for interpreting them, and the  Scheme is a general-purpose programming language, descended from Algol and Lisp, widely used in computing education and research and a broad range of   Scheme is great for trying out new language semantics because it has very simple, powerful primitives and the uniform syntax lets you  The Scheme Programming Language stands alone as an introduction to and essential reference for Scheme programmers.

Scheme programming languages

It covers *why* Scheme is a great language and Functional Programming Overview • Pure functional programming – No implicit notion of state – No need for assignment statement • No side effect – Looping • No state variable • Use Recursion • Most functional programming languages have side effects, including Scheme – Assignments – Input/Output Scheme Programming Overview The light-weight and fastest web-framework of Scheme language. Artanis home A fast Choosing proper equal pred for you code, is one of the art in Scheme programming! Being a C like language counts in favor for it as a general purpose programming language, given the ease of using existing skills to pick up this language easily. there are other superior languages that could be used as a general purpose, such as: F#, Haskell, but the complexity of those languages, being functional, make them strange to the usual C Syntax.
Endocardium is the inner lining of the heart

Scheme programming languages

In Scheme and Functional Programming, 2006.

Lisp is the next oldest programming language - only Fortran is older. In scheme which is a functional programming language, there is no assignment statement.
Avdrag tjänsteresor schablon

Scheme programming languages egen elförsörjning
bredband ingen bindningstid
preserna ana
lerum lediga jobb
piezo motors

Providing IT professionals with a unique blend of original content, peer-to-peer advice from the largest community of IT leaders on the Web. This article is also available as a TechRepublic download. F# (pronounced F Sharp) is a functional

Code examples. Guile is an implementation of the Scheme programming language, supporting the Revised 5 and most of the Revised 6 language reports, as well as many SRFIs.It also comes with a library of modules that offer additional features, like an HTTP server and client, XML parsing, and object-oriented programming. The Scheme Programming Language (3/e), R. Kent Dybvig, MIT Press, 2003 How to Design Programs , Matthias Felleisen, Robert Bruce Findler, Matthew Flatt and Shriram Krishnamurthi, MIT Press, 2001 (available in full on-line, date is for print version) functional programming languages include ML, SML, and Lisp/Scheme.


Namaste india
norton kundtjänst

Comparative study of the Pros and Cons of Programming languages Java, Scala, C++, Haskell, VB .NET, AspectJ, Perl, Ruby, PHP & Scheme - … Historic 

language name, and standard libraries, both are distinct languages and vary javascript in their homework. Self and Scheme programming languages were the​  We're going to be focusing on first a programming language called Haskell. Vi kommer att fokusera på först Vi hjälper dig att ladda ner och installera C++ Programming Language Pro på din dator i 4 enkla steg.